>> As part of the GCG´s meeting held two days ago, one of the follow up
>> items that we agreed to act upon immediately is to develop a strategy to
>> raise funds to help to reach out to pastoralist  groups in remote areas, to
>> ensure their access to information as part of securing their timely and
>> full participation throughout the IYRP process.
>>
>>
>>
>> To this end, a committee was formed integrated by Anders, Hijaba and
>> myself with the accompaniment of Maryam.
>>
>>
>>
>> A proposal of this nature depends entirely upon your input. Hence, could
>> you please send us by April 12th the needs you have for reaching out to
>> key pastoralists groups in remote areas within your regions? Please
>> consider focusing on mobility and mobile pastoralists, but don´t
>> hesitate to also take into account pastoralists who use extensive native
>> rangelands, but may not be as mobile. Thank you
>>
>>
>>
>> The information we would much welcome related to your pastoralist groups
>> in need is:
>>
>> 1. Name and overall size of the pastoralist group
>>
>> 2. Geographic distribution
>>
>> 3. Main activity that needs to be supported and how would be implemented
>>
>> 4. Amount required
>>
>> 5. Periodicity (permanent, seasonal, or event-based e.g. annual meeting,
>> etc.)
>>
>>
>>
>> With your input we will develop a draft rationale and concept package to
>> share with you and once we have a final version we can then use to present
>> to potential donor organizations. We are also exploring what donor
>> organizations could be interested in supporting these outreach activities,
>> so please don't hesitate to let us know if you have any suggestions
>> that you would like us to approach. Thank you.
